discounters

[US]/[dɪˈskaʊntəz]/
[UK]/[dɪˈskaʊntərz]/
Frequency: Very High

Translation

n.People or companies that offer goods at discounted prices.; Stores or businesses that frequently offer discounts.; A person who buys goods at a discount and resells them at a higher price.
